Power to the Patient! Access of Consumerization

The consumerization of health is about patient empowerment. From health apps that help monitor chronic conditions to online platforms that access health information, individuals are growing accustomed to a more active role in their health care. Retail outlets are extending their health services beyond the traditional pharmacy. In this session we’ll explore how products developed by Amazon, retailers (ie. Walmart) and ride share services (Uber Health) are increasing access to healthcare and creating opportunities for individuals and communities. What are the opportunities for healthcare systems, tech startups, social services and other consumer brands to work together? Learn what’s working, pitfalls to avoid and how changes in consumer expectations are influencing industry norms.
